Webmake your blood run cold or make your blood freeze If something makes your blood run cold or makes your blood freeze, it frightens or shocks you very much. The rage in his eyes made her blood run cold. It makes my blood run cold to think what this poor, helpless child must have gone through. Webin cold blood without feeling or mercy; ruthlessly. According to medieval physiology blood was naturally hot, and so this phrase refers to an unnatural state in which someone can carry out a (hot-blooded) deed of passion or violence without the normal heating of the … blood gas analysis laboratory studies of arterial and venous blood for the purpose … BLOOD, kindred.
